25/1/2004 Edition No.33 Adelaide
and Crown Casino LATEST: On a recent trip to Adelaide we found good conditions, despite a cut approaching two decks. Sky City is probably the only Australian casino that hasn’t experimented with the dreaded pontoon. In fact, from Thursday to Sunday nights there are plenty of low-minimum blackjack tables ($15 or less) with enough customers to produce a tidy house profit. Table-hopping is the ideal counter technique with new shuffles happening all the time. Pontoon, or Spanish 21 as it is known in the United States, has died a natural death there as it will eventually in Australia. Crown appears to be going through another period of flushing out "undesirables". We have received emails about and personally witnessed a casino policy of intimidation; using security personnel to enforce player restrictions. Management are well aware that advantage players are not cheats; however for reasons known only to them, they relay the cheating myth to security. Obviously this misinformation has the potential to lead to a violent confrontation. A reminder is also needed that Crown’s main floors are part of the "public domain". This was decreed by the Victorian State Government when the non-smoking policy began. Therefore, according to legal advice received, law-abiding patrons cannot be trespassed!
